Transaction 6329970fef51e077b1ce2ff24865c6a930af451cba24a1715dc5b55d24175f81
1 Input
2 Outputs
- 6329970fef51e077b1ce2ff24865c6a930af451cba24a1715dc5b55d24175f81:0
- 6329970fef51e077b1ce2ff24865c6a930af451cba24a1715dc5b55d24175f81:1
value 2910000
address 382TUqe2CuGVUXMi9WFQe5cwJiK5MTUJK4
value 11247
address 18sPCkrz8hHtudL2QqoKx53TmpUbuqQ3Sz